  • Captain Henry Avery (or Every) is perhaps one of, if not the most successful pirate to ever live. Sailing the seas in the 17th and 18th century, Avery is most well known for his attack on the Mughal flagship, the 'Ganj-i-Sawi' which he looted about 300,00 - 600,000 British pounds from. This translates to tens of millions dollars in today's currency, which makes this one of the biggest pirate heists in history.
    Yet, many are unfamiliar with Avery. The reasoning behind this may be intentional, as Avery did what most pirates never could - he disappeared. His disappearance is one that has perplexed scholars for years and in turn, has only made his story evermore intriguing.
